About this listen

Can an old letter spark a new flame?

When Tess Ravenel gets herself stuck inside a bathroom stall in one of Charleston's most historic buildings, she isn't exactly thinking about her dating life. But then the paramedic who comes to her rescue has a voice that sounds like butter and enough charm to make her forget she's seconds from having a panic attack.

If only he were interested.

Andrew McKay has a mysterious Christmas pen pal, a woman who replied to a newly found letter he sent to Santa back when he was a kid. After weeks of correspondence, it's clear she's funny, smart, interesting... and an awful lot like Tess Ravanel—the woman he's already blown off twice for good reason.

Tess and Andrew couldn't be more different, but when their worlds collide, fate (and a little Christmas magic) set them on a crash course for love.

The Christmas Letters is a closed-door sweet holiday romance with lots of chemistry but no spice.
